itk-snap安装
时间: 2023-10-20 13:08:55 浏览: 387
引用中提到了安装itk-snap的命令和步骤,具体如下:
1. 首先,在命令提示符(cmd)中使用"cd"命令切换到itk-snap文件夹的路径下。
2. 然后,执行以下命令来克隆itk-snap的源代码:git clone --recursive [email protected]:pyushkevich/itksnap.git itksnap。
引用中提供了两篇文章作为安装流程的参考,一篇是官方的文档,另一篇是CSDN上的一篇3.8版本的安装文档。你可以参考这两篇文章了解更多详细的安装步骤和注意事项。
引用提供了一些环境配置的建议,包括安装环境的要求和推荐的版本。根据个人使用的环境,可能会有一些差异。建议使用最新的环境,并确保安装了64位的Python3.9.2、vs2019 16.11 community、qt6.2.2、cmake3.25和git2.38.1。在准备阶段,可能还需要配置好Python2的环境。如果安装的是3.8版本,需要使用vs2017,因为最新版本的itk-snap需要用到itk5.2.1,而itk又需要qt6和vs2019。
相关问题
ITK-SNAP
### ITK-SNAP 软件下载及使用说明
#### 一、ITK-SNAP简介
ITK-SNAP 是一款用于医学图像分割和分析的强大工具,支持多种功能,包括图像配准效果的可视化评估。它能够实现固定图像与配准图像的重叠对比,从而方便研究人员快速验证算法性能[^1]。
#### 二、软件下载地址
官方提供了预编译版本供用户直接下载安装,无需额外配置环境即可使用。访问以下链接可找到最新稳定版的下载页面:
- 官方网站: https://www.itksnap.org/pmwiki/pmwiki.php?n=Downloads.Snap3D
点击对应操作系统的安装包进行下载。对于Windows用户,默认提供.exe格式的安装程序;Linux 和 macOS 用户则可以选择压缩包形式的分发文件[^2]。
#### 三、基本安装流程
##### 对于Windows平台:
1. 执行已下载好的`.exe`文件启动向导界面;
2. 遵循提示完成路径设置和其他选项指定;
3. 启动完成后可在桌面或者开始菜单里看到快捷方式图标。
##### 如果希望从源码构建(适用于高级开发者):
需先准备好必要的开发套件如CMake和Visual Studio等IDE环境之后按照如下步骤执行:
1. 获取最新的源代码仓库副本可以通过Git命令克隆远程库到本地机器上;
2. 使用CMake GUI加载工程定义脚本(CMakeLists.txt),调整参数直至生成解决方案成功为止 ;
3. 利用MSVC打开产生的.sln方案文档,在其中依次调用ALL_BUILD目标项来完成整体组装过程后再单独触发INSTALL任务以正式部署应用程序实例至系统默认位置处[^3]。
#### 四、初步使用的指导方针
当一切准备就绪以后就可以着手尝试一些基础的操作啦!比如导入DICOM序列数据集作为输入素材进而观察三维重建后的模型表现情况等等...以下是几个常用的功能模块概述:
- **File Menu**: 主要负责管理项目的创建保存以及外部资源加载等功能.
- **View Options**: 自定义显示风格,例如颜色映射表的选择或是透明度等级调节等方面的内容都在这里集中体现出来 .
- **Segmentation Tools**: 提供了一系列针对特定区域标记描绘的服务接口以便后续统计计算之用.
以上便是关于如何获取并开启初体验之旅的大致描述了~当然除此之外还有更多深层次的知识等待着大家去探索发现呢!
```python
# 示例 Python 脚本展示如何通过 SimpleITK 接口读取 NIfTI 文件并将其转换成 NumPy 数组形式便于进一步处理分析
import SimpleITK as sitk
def load_nifti_image(file_path):
img = sitk.ReadImage(file_path) # 加载 nii 格式的影像资料
np_array = sitk.GetArrayFromImage(img)# 将 SITK 图像对象转化为 numpy array 类型变量
return np_array # 返回结果给调用者继续利用下去
example_file = 'path/to/your/image.nii'
data_matrix = load_nifti_image(example_file)
print(data_matrix.shape)
```
ITK-snap error
回答: 出现ITK-SNAP错误的原因可能是在上一次打开ITK-SNAP时,出现了文件打开错误或者图像包含中文路径,导致在下次启动时读取错误。为了解决这个问题,可以尝试以下方法:新建一个卷,将文件夹名称改短,然后重新进行configure、generate,curl、OpenCV、VTK、ITK和ITK-SNAP。这样可能解决问题。另外,如果在ITK-SNAP 7.5生成时遇到MSB3073错误,可以参考一些相关的博客和文章来解决问题。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[Exception occurred during ITK-SNAP startup](https://blog.csdn.net/Castlehe/article/details/124566621)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[Build ITK-SNAP3.8 Windows系统下编译](https://blog.csdn.net/rmbhui/article/details/127845243)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文
相关推荐













